The Impact of Social Media
Social media platforms have become integral to the dissemination of news in Hong Kong. With the widespread use of smartphones and high-speed internet, plat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ram have become powerful tools for breaking news and engaging with audiences. News organizations are increasingly using these platforms to share updates, interact with readers, and gather feedback.
However, the rise of social media has also brought challenges, such as the spread of misinformation and fake news. To combat this, reputable news outlets in Hong Kong are investing in fact-checking initiatives and promoting media literacy among the public. By fostering a culture of critical thinking and responsible journalism, these outlets aim to ensure that accurate and reliable information prevails in the digital age.
Challenges and Opportunities
The media industry in Hong Kong faces a myriad of challenges, including economic pressures, regulatory changes, and the need to maintain journalistic integrity. The competitive nature of the market requires news organizations to constantly innovate and adapt to stay relevant. Despite these challenges, there are numerous opportunities for growth and development.
One such opportunity lies in the growing demand for multimedia content. As audiences increasingly seek out engaging and interactive news experiences, news organizations are investing in video production, podcasts, and interactive graphics. By diversifying their content offerings, these organizations can attract a broader audience and enhance their competitive edge.
The Future of Hong Kong News
The future of Hong Kong’s media landscape is bright, with numerous advancements on the horizon. The integ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ning technologies promises to revolutionize news production and distribution. These technologies can automate routine tasks, analyze large datasets, and provide personalized news recommendations, enhancing the overall user experience.
Additionally, the rise of citizen journalism and user-generated content is reshaping the way news is reported and consumed. By empowering individuals to contribute to the news-gathering process, news organizations can tap into a wealth of diverse perspectives and enhance the richness of their coverage. As the media landscape continues to evolve, collaboration and innovation will be key to navigating the challenges and opportunities that lie ahead.
